Star Cookies


These crisp, spicy cookies make a perfect snack after a day of sledding or
ice skating. Serve them with big pitchers of mulled wine and hot chocolate.
This recipe makes about 30 to 40 stars, depending on the size of your cookie
cutter.

1. Preheat the oven to 275 degrees F.
2. Grease and lightly flour a baking sheet.
3. Gather your ingredients (see shopping list, below).
4. Sift flour.
5. Mix in remaining ingredients.
6. Roll out the dough to a thickness of about 1/8 inch.
7. Cut with a star-shaped cookie cutter.
8. Lift the stars carefully with a spatula and lay them on a baking sheet.
9. Bake for 15 minutes at 275 degrees F.
10. Remove cookies from oven and dust them with powdered sugar.

Tips:
Lifting the freshly cut cookies can be tricky, but the more you practice,
the easier it gets.

Warnings:
If you're allergic to nuts, or if you don't like the taste of almonds,
these cookies are not for you.
